The global optical coating equipment market is expected to grow at a CAGR of 7.2% during the forecast period from 2021 to 2028. The market is primarily driven by the increasing demand for optical coatings in various applications such as consumer electronics, aerospace, defense, and automotive.
Optical coating equipment is used for depositing thin layers of materials on optical surfaces to enhance their properties such as reflectivity, transmittance, and durability. These coatings are widely used in various industries such as medical, aerospace, defense, and consumer electronics.

Global Optical Coating Equipment Market: Market Restraints
- High capital investment: The high capital investment required for optical coating equipment is a major restraint for the market. The equipment is expensive, and the cost of maintenance and operation is also high.
- Lack of skilled professionals: The lack of skilled professionals is another major restraint for the market. The operation and maintenance of optical coating equipment require specialized knowledge and skills, which are in short supply.
- Volatility in raw material prices: The volatility in raw material prices is a major restraint for the market. The cost of raw materials such as metals, oxides, and nitrides is subject to fluctuations, which affects the profitability of the market players.

Global Optical Coating Equipment Market: Category-wise Insights
The global optical coating equipment market can be categorized into vacuum deposition, ion-assisted deposition, and others. The vacuum deposition segment is expected to dominate the market during the forecast period, driven by its high efficiency and reliability. Vacuum deposition is widely used in various applications such as optical coatings, semiconductor fabrication, and surface engineering.
The ion-assisted deposition segment is also expected to witness significant growth in the coming years, driven by its ability to produce high-quality coatings with superior adhesion and durability. Ion-assisted deposition is widely used in various applications such as optical coatings, hard coatings, and wear-resistant coatings.
